The Arbitration Agreement serves as a legally binding document that stipulates the resolution of disputes arising from the sale or financing of a manufactured home in North Carolina. This agreement outlines the definition of arbitration within the capital structure, emphasizing its utility in mitigating potential litigation costs and expediting conflict resolution. Key features include the provision for binding arbitration administered by the American Arbitration Association, the requirement for written notice to initiate arbitration, and the stipulation that claims under twenty thousand dollars be heard by a single arbitrator. Filling instructions are clear, requiring parties to provide personal information and details related to their claims. The agreement protects the rights of all parties involved by allowing for equitable resolution and maintaining confidentiality.
